6.4.4 Window protection
The WP checks the conditions at the output pins of the power stage and is activated:
During the start-up sequence, when pin MODE is switched from standby to mute. In
the event of a short-circuit at one of the output pins to VDD or VSS the start-up
procedure is interrupted and the TDF8591TH waits until the short-circuit to the supply
lines has been removed. Because the test is done before enabling the power stages,
no large currents will flow in the event of a short-circuit.
When the amplifier is completely shut down due to activation of the OCP by a
short-circuit to one of the supply lines, the window protection will then be activated
during restart (after 100 ms). As a result the amplifier will not start up until the
short-circuit to the supply lines is removed.
6.4.5 Supply voltage protections
If the supply voltage drops below
±12.5 V, the UVP circuit is activated and the
TDF8591TH switch-off will be silent and without pop noise. When the supply voltage rises
above
±12.5 V, the TDF8591TH is restarted again after 100 ms.
If the supply voltage exceeds
±33 V the OVP circuit is activated and the power stages will
shut down. It is re-enabled as soon as the supply voltage drops below
±33 V. So in this
case no timer of 100 ms is started. The maximum operating supply voltage is
±29 V and if
the supply voltage is above the maximal allowable voltage of
±34 V (see Section 7), the
TDF8591TH can be damaged, irrespective of an activated OVP. See Section 12.6
“Pumping effects” for more information about the use of the OVP.
An additional UBP circuit compares the positive analog (VDDA) and the negative analog
(VSSA) supply voltages and is triggered if the voltage difference between them exceeds
the unbalance threshold level, which is expressed as follows:

When the supply voltage difference VDDA − VSSA exceeds Vth(unb), the TDF8591TH
switches off and is restarted again after 100 ms.
Example: With a symmetrical supply of VDDA = 20 V and VSSA = −20 V, the unbalance
protection circuit will be triggered if the unbalance exceeds approximately 6 V.
